Associazione Sportiva Dilettantistica Villafranca is an Italian association football club, based in Villafranca di Verona, Veneto. It currently plays in Serie D.

History[edit]

The foundation[edit]

The club was founded in 1920.

Serie D[edit]

At the end of the 2010–11 Serie D season, Villafranca was relegated to Eccellenza after the play-out, but on 5 August 2011 it was readmitted to fill vacancies.[1]

In the season 2011–12 it was again relegated to Eccellenza.

Colors and badge[edit]

The team's colors are white and dark blue.
